Chori-steak
Lily N.

I'm from Royal Oak and I accidentally called the wrong location for take out. I meant to order from Madison Heights but ordered from the Troy location instead. This is my first tile ordering from Troy and to me surprise it is the exact same!! My go to order is the chori-steak and my boyfriend orders the chori-pollo. When you order it comes with your meat along with refried beans, rice, and three small flour tortillas. Everything is always SO GOOD. Seriously I crave Grand Azteca's chori-steak on a daily basis. It's a full steak with the chorizo on top and a cheese sauce on top. To die for. Highly recommend. My favorite Mexican restaurant.

Excellent Mexican Street taco joint. For my first visit here I ordered two Asada (steak) street…read moretaco's that were very authentic and had only cilantro, both fresh cut and sautéed onions, fresh lime slice on the side, all on top of two fried corn tortillas. The meats was very tender & flavorful, veggies quite fresh and finished product very very tasty. As a cautionary note, the Salsa was probably a medium on the spicy scale and if you like your food mild you may want to ask for the mild salsa that comes with the chips. Other item of note here is the chips and salsa come gratis if you dine in where they were good but not quite at the level as the taco's which were over the top good! Relative to the restaurant and staff, the facility itself has a smallish footprint where there are just two tables and one very long counter with stools for indoor dining. My take of this is that much of the business is probably carryout. Staff was very friendly where you order your food at the counter and they bring it to you if you are dining in the restaurant. there was no table follow up at this point where it really operate as a quasi fast food joint which I was totally OK with, Overall really good food at a very reasonable price (2 steak taco's were $8) where the taco's are some of the best I have had in Metro Detroit. If you are a fan of good authentic Mexican food than this is a business not to be missed.

Excellent hole in the wall taco joint that splits its retail space as half restaurant and half…read moregrocery. The restaurant itself has a relatively small foot print where the tables are close together and where there are no frills about this place and definately a tad on the rustic side. Facility aside, this place makes some excellent authentic Mexican street tacos where my El Pastor and Asada taco's were well made, PACKED with meat (no scrimping here) and oh so tasty. Service is quite quick where once seated you get your food within a few minutes making this an excellent spot if you are on the run and looking for a good meal on the quick. Prices are cheap in my opinion where my three taco's and a coke came to just $12. NICE! Two things to note here is that the chips and salsa are not gratis but come at an extra cost and follow up once you get food was non existent in my case. Chips and salsa was not a big deal to me but lack of follow up prevented this business from getting a fifth star. Overall and my minor gripes aside, if you are fan of really good Mexican street taco's than this is a must visit if you are in the area!
